Give length of string = 120cm.
It is bent into a square.
So, perimeter of square is 120cm.
We know that perimetre of square is -sum of all sides or 4×side
Let lenght of a side be x
Now,
4 × x = 120
4x = 120
x = 120/4
x = 30
So, lenght of one side is 30cm.
